Overview

: In this fast, fun, COMIC book edition of Word of Mouth Marketing: How Smart Companies Get People Talking, you'll learn to quickly get people talking about you. The original is the #1 word of mouth marketing book since 2004, translated into 14 languages. This exciting new graphic novel edition makes these fantastically useful ideas even easier to read, implement, and share. The comic edition is a great way to teach word of mouth marketing to teams that need it most but don't have the time to sit down with the complete book. For fans of the full book, the comic makes a great back-pocket guide for your day-to-day marketing. With straightforward advice and humor, Andy Sernovitz will show you how the world's most respected and profitable companies get their best customers for free through the power of word of mouth. Learn the five essential steps that make word of mouth work and everything you need to get started. Understand how easy it is to work with social media, viral marketing, evangelists, and buzz. Start using simple techniques that start conversations: 3 Reasons People Talk About You 4 Rules of Word of Mouth Marketing 5 Ts of Word of Mouth Marketing 6 Big Ideas: Deep Stuff That Changes Marketing Forever Learn to use word of mouth marketing to make your company more profitable, how to spend less on marketing, and how to make your customers happier.
